信息系统开发生命周期中的安全技术实践(四)

信息系统开发生命周期中的安全技术实践
随着科技的发展和普及,各行各业都越来越依赖于信息系统的支持。然而,随之而来的安全风险也不可忽视。为了保护信息系统和其中的数据免受潜在的威胁,安全技术实践在信息系统开发生命周期中扮演着重要的角。本文将讨论一些重要的安全技术实践,以保证信息系统开发过程中的安全性。
1. 风险评估和需求分析阶段
信息系统开发生命周期的第一步是进行风险评估和需求分析。在这个阶段,团队需要认识到潜在的威胁和安全漏洞,并将其纳入需求分析。例如,如果涉及用户数据的系统,个人隐私可能需要被保护,因此加密技术可能是必要的。在这个阶段,团队需要与安全专家合作,确定适当的安全需求,并为后续步骤打下基础。
2. 安全设计和架构阶段
在系统设计和架构阶段,团队需要考虑信息系统的整体安全性。这包括网络拓扑设计、访问控制策略等。为了提供强大的防御机制,团队需要考虑采用防火墙、IDS/IPS(入侵检测/
入侵预防系统)等技术来阻止未经授权的访问和恶意攻击。此外,访问控制策略应该确保只有授权用户可以访问敏感数据,例如采用权限管理和多因素身份验证。
3. 安全编码和测试阶段
在代码编写和测试阶段,团队需要采取一些安全编码实践来保障系统的安全性。首先,团队应该遵循最佳实践的编码规范,例如避免使用已知的漏洞函数、输入验证和输出编码。其次,安全测试必不可少。通过进行漏洞扫描、代码审查和渗透测试等,团队可以发现和修复系统中的潜在漏洞,从而提高系统的安全性。
4. 部署和维护阶段
系统部署后,安全技术实践也应该继续。团队应该持续监控系统的安全状况,及时修补已知漏洞,确保系统的抗攻击性能。此外,定期的安全审计和评估可以发现系统中的安全隐患,并采取相应的措施进行改进。而且,团队还应该制定紧急响应计划,以应对意外的安全事件,减少损失。
5. 培训和意识教育阶段
安全技术实践不仅限于开发团队,也需要渗透到整个组织中。为了提高员工的安全意识和技能,组织应该定期进行安全培训和意识教育。这样可以帮助员工识别和应对潜在的安全风险,确保整个组织对信息安全的共同关注。
总结起来,信息系统开发生命周期中的安全技术实践是一项重要的工作。通过风险评估和需求分析、安全设计和架构、安全编码和测试、部署和维护、培训和意识教育等多个环节的安全实践,我们可以大大提高信息系统的安全性。然而,安全是一个持续的过程,团队和组织需要时刻保持对信息安全的关注,并及时适应不断变化的安全威胁。系统平台开发评估

本文发布于:2024-09-23 15:32:13,感谢您对本站的认可!

本文链接:https://www.17tex.com/tex/4/379337.html

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。

标签:团队   需要   系统   信息系统   应该   实践   开发   技术
留言与评论(共有 0 条评论)
   
验证码:
Copyright ©2019-2024 Comsenz Inc.Powered by © 易纺专利技术学习网 豫ICP备2022007602号 豫公网安备41160202000603 站长QQ:729038198 关于我们 投诉建议